Just because you are measuring big has nothing to do with how or when you will be delivering. Doctors really don't worry about how big the baby is getting until you are well over measuring 4 weeks ahead. A week, even 2 1/2 weeks is nothing. Babies will go through growth spurts and your appt. just happens to fall during that time and the next time around you maybe be back to measuring right on time again.
I honestly, wouldn't put much stock in any measurements at this point. Because they are historically inaccurate.
